For 5 years, Eurasian Collared-doves have frequented my yard in Colorado 
Springs. They are somewhat aggressive toward Mourning Doves, but have not 
driven them from the yard. 

This year I observed some VERY aggressive behavior by doves toward American 
Crows, a pair of which nests in a neighbor's tree. One or 2 of the doves have 
begun chasing crows at high speed through the yard and adjoining property. The 
doves fly right on the tails of the crows, outmaneuvering the crows in the air. 
The harassment is not limited to aerial pursuit, but now includes attacks on 
crows on the ground. The crows are bigger and present more of a physical threat 
to the doves, but for some reason, the doves have intimidated the local crows.

Has anyone else observed similar behavior?
